Abstract

An augmented reality system for use with security systems comprises an augmented reality engine that provides information concerning devices of a security system and a display device that combines the security system information from the augmented reality engine onto a representation or view of the surrounding physical, real-world environment. The system can be used for inspection, installation and/or servicing, for example. In application, it can be used to facilitate inspection including periodic testing to ensure that a fire detection and alarm system, for example, is in compliance with building and safety codes.
